I wonder. If we have a condenser to control the escaping steam, wouldn't a standard, home-kitchen-sized, that is to say, affordable, range exhaust hood be able to control the odors? I realize make-up air has to enter the space from somewhere, but the volume would be very much less.
Interesting question, to which I'm going to (speculatively) answer "no."
Here's why I think that: a standard exhaust hood setup will take the rising steam, most of which ends up inside the hood, and exhaust it to the outside. Given the airflow, other volatile boil constituents will also rise up and be exhausted.
Now, take one of our steam condenser setups. Even if you have an exhaust hood over it, from where is it drawing the air? From everywhere. There's nothing carrying steam and other boil constituents up directly into the fan and thus to the outside.
That air will come from everywhere, not just from below. Inside that range hood the fan creates a negative pressure; it will be fed with air from all sides and below the hood, not just from below.
Thus, while it will vent something, it's not going to vent a lot, at least not compared to an exhaust vent into which steam is rising.
